收藏
回答

关于movable-view和 swiper一起使用时,x,y重置为0,movable会超出父容器?

  1. 运行环境:

本地运行环境如图

  1. 出现的问题详细描述,代码片段已经上传,我这里讲讲

a问题:x,y为0,位置不对

首次的位置如下

通过最简单的flex布局,让首次进来的图片水平垂直居中。此时是正常的。

然后,代码中,通过点击放大图片,再次点击还原时候,希望通过x,y设置,回一开始布局原点。

而通过x,y还原后,位置如下:

预期,x,y为0时,应该是最上面的居中的情况。

b问题描述如下:

通过开发者工具可以看到,area区域的大小是844.正好与屏幕大小是一致的。而子容器movable-view的大小也是和图片大小是一致的。

出现的问题是,通过拖拽会超出父容器area的区域,表现如图:

向下超出

向上也超出:

预期应该和屏幕上下一致,不超出



回答关注问题邀请回答
收藏

1 个回答

  • 智能回答 智能回答 该问答由AI生成
    03-25
    有用
登录 后发表内容